About the Bose® FreeSpace® 360P II

An outdoor speaker that blends into the landscape
An outdoor speaker that blends into the landscape
The Bose FreeSpace 360P II environmental speaker is rugged enough to stay outside all the time, and it can be hidden out of sight or partially buried so it doesn't interfere with your property's landscaping. Its 4-1/2" full-range driver and clever 360-degree horizontal distribution pattern ensures that customers in outdoor spaces hear high-quality music and clear, intelligible announcements.
Note: This speaker is only compatible with 70V/100V commercial systems.

Product Research
Features
Overview: The Bose FreeSpace 360P Series II is a full-range, 70/100 volt environmental loudspeaker designed to blend with landscaping for in-ground or above-ground applications such as outdoor malls, restaurant patios, resorts, and theme parks. The 360P consists of a single 4.5" full-range driver in a ported enclosure that gives 360˚ of horizontal and 50˚ of vertical coverage with a frequency response that goes down to 60 Hz.
Enclosure: Housed in a heavy duty, glass-reinforced, polypropylene enclosure with a composite driver, the 360P is able to withstand snow, rain, salt and temperatures ranging from 158˚F to -40˚F. The freestanding design with simplified mounting allows for fast and secure installation to the ground or attached to a horizontal concrete or wood surface. It can also be semi-buried up to 6.5", so that only the top half of the speaker is visible. The cabinet shape acts as an acoustic diffuser directing mid and high frequencies out towards listeners. The base of the speaker acts as a tuned, multi-chambered ported enclosure while the domed port grill reflects sound into the listening area for clear, consistent performance. Three screw holes around the base of the speaker allow it to be secured to a mounting surface for tamper-resistance.
70/100 Volt: The FreeSpace 360P is rated for 80 watt RMS (320 peak) and can be used with both 70 and 100 volt systems. A built-in wiring pig-tail includes individual wires for each of the tap settings (in lieu of a tap "dial") as well as the input wires. Eight wire-nuts are provided for connections. These have sealed slots where the wire is inserted and are filled with dielectric grease to help prevent wire corrosion.The following wattages are available for both 70 and 100 volt applications: 10 W, 20 W, 40 W, and 80 W.
Specifications:
- Frequency Response (+/- 3 dB): 70 Hz - 10 kHz
- Frequency Range (-10 dB): 60 Hz - 15 kHz
- Nominal Dispersion: 360˚ H x 50˚ V
- Recommended High-Pass Filter: 60 Hz high-pass
- Overload Protection: PTC
- Power Handling: 80 W (320 W peak)
- Sensitivity: 87 dB SPL
- Maximum SPL: 100 dB SPL (106 db SPL peak)
- Nominal Impedance: 4Ω (transformer bypassed)
- Transformer Taps (70/100 V): 10 W, 20 W, 40 W, 80 W
- Driver: 4.5" full-range, environmental driver
- Enclosure: Glass-reinforced polypropylene, textured
- Environmental: Outdoor per IEC 529 IP35
- Connectors: External multi-wire cable (18 AWG) with included wire nuts
- Dimensions: Diameter - 14.50", Height - 15.0"
- Weight: 14.5 lbs.
